Compound Growth Rate Formula

Understanding Compound Growth Rate

The compound growth rate, often denoted as CAGR (Compound Annual Growth Rate), is a crucial metric in finance and economics that measures the rate of return of an investment over a specified period of time, taking into account the compounding effect. It represents the idea that the investment generates returns on its returns, leading to exponential growth over time. The formula for calculating compound growth rate is essential for investors, financial analysts, and businesses to assess the performance of investments and make informed decisions.

Compound Growth Rate Formula

The formula for calculating the compound growth rate is as follows: [ CAGR = \left( \frac{End\ Value}{Beginning\ Value} \right)^{\frac{1}{Number\ of\ Years}} - 1 ] Where: - End Value is the final value of the investment after the specified period. - Beginning Value is the initial value of the investment. - Number of Years is the duration over which the investment is held.

This formula can be applied to various financial metrics, including stock prices, revenue growth, and portfolio returns, to understand the annualized growth rate.

Example Calculation

Suppose an investor purchases a stock for 100 and sells it for 150 after 3 years. To find the compound annual growth rate of this investment: [ CAGR = \left( \frac{150}{100} \right)^{\frac{1}{3}} - 1 ] [ CAGR = \left( 1.5 \right)^{\frac{1}{3}} - 1 ] [ CAGR = 1.1447 - 1 ] [ CAGR = 0.1447 ] [ CAGR = 14.47\% ] Therefore, the compound annual growth rate of this investment is approximately 14.47%.

Importance of Compound Growth Rate

Understanding the compound growth rate is vital for several reasons: - Investment Evaluation: It helps in comparing the performance of different investments over the same period, allowing for a more informed decision-making process. - Future Projections: By applying the compound growth rate, one can estimate the future value of an investment, aiding in long-term financial planning. - Risk Assessment: A higher CAGR might indicate higher risk, as investments with higher returns typically come with higher volatility.

Factors Affecting Compound Growth Rate

Several factors can influence the compound growth rate of an investment: - Interest Rate: Higher interest rates can increase the compound growth rate, as more money is earned on interest. - Compounding Frequency: The frequency at which interest is compounded (e.g., monthly, quarterly, annually) affects the overall return. - Initial Investment: A larger initial investment can lead to a higher absolute return, although the CAGR might remain the same. - Market Conditions: Economic downturns or upswings significantly impact investment growth rates.
